Ivan Espinosa will now guide Nissan through its drastic turnaround effort and potentially a revival of merger talks with Honda. By Stewart Burnett

Just hours after Nissan held its 10 March 2025 board meeting to discuss the future of Chief Executive Makoto Uchida—and his potential successor—the automaker has announced he is stepping down. Taking his place is former Chief Planning Officer Ivan Espinosa, marking the fourth change in the company’s top leadership role in six years.
